Sustainable investments
Our goal is to maximise HESTA members’ investment returns while minimising risk.
We believe that environmental, social and governance (ESG) considerations are key to unlocking an investment’s value. These factors help us to understand investment risks and opportunities.
We are is a signatory to the United Nations Principles for Responsible Investment (UNPRI). It’s the central framework we use to assess ESG and investments. The HESTA ESG Policy explains it in detail. Read more...
We helped to form ESG Research Australia (ESG RA). This body supports analysts and investment managers to research how ESG issues affect investments. Read more...
We also helped found the Investor Group on Climate Change (IGCC). This organisation works with Australian governments on climate change policy, and takes part in the Australian Carbon Disclosure Project. Further information on the IGCC can be found at igcc.org.au.
And we've created Eco Pool. This member investment option focuses on assets that show best-practice environmental and sustainability performance.
Corporate governance and active ownership
We believe that good corporate governance is critical to the value of HESTA's investments and in achieving our investment objective. We think of this in terms of ‘active ownership', meaning that we are active in supporting good corporate governance in companies and other assets, and seeking to achieve change where we think that governance is poor or less than ideal.
Such matters where we will be active include:
- the independence of the board, board committees, executive remuneration
- the voting rights of shareholders
- appointment of auditors
- conflicts of interest
- take-overs and acquisitions.
We perform our active ownership role on behalf of HESTA members in two main ways:
- share voting; and
- engagement with companies, regulators and governments.

Business practices
Our passion for sustainability influences our internal operations.
The HESTA Sustainability Coordinator and Committee work to make HESTA as sustainable as possible:
- we offer all members the choice of electronic or printed statements and brochures
- the printers of our brochures use environmental management systems that are certified to ISO 14001 standard. They’re also Eco Warranty certified
- our waste management practices minimise the amount of waste we send to landfill. They also ensure we recycle as much as possible
- our Carbon Management Strategy aims to continually reduce HESTA's carbon footprint.
